Nevada makes nearly $36 million in taxes off recreational marijuana

Posted

Figures released by Nevada’s Department of Taxation show that since recreational marijuana was allowed to be sold in July, the state has collected nearly $36 million in taxes.

Nevada collects a 15 percent wholesale tax on medical and recreational sales and another 10 percent tax on recreational marijuana.

The closest recreational dispensary to Utah is in Mesquite, Nev.

West Wendover has been contemplating recreational cannabis sales but an ordinance allowing it has stalled.
